WebDec 22, 2024 · How to whip cream, step by step. First, pour cold heavy cream/heavy whipping cream into a large mixing bowl or the bowl of a stand mixer. In a standard KitchenAid mixer, one pint (two cups) of cream whips up beautifully. Add sugar. For most purposes, we like to add ¼ cup of granulated sugar to one pint of heavy cream.

On a cutting board, or clean surface, lay out 1 slice of deli meat (if the meat is sliced thin … duty of care wwcWebSep 8, 2024 · Whipped cream is heavy cream that has been beaten until it is light and fluffy. It may be beaten with (in order from easiest to hardest) a mixer, a whisk or a fork.
